I have been running 2 instances of d2r for awhile now and just purchased a third copy on a third bnet account .
I copied the original D2R folder contents and placed them in my newly renamed folder for the third and sent a shortcut to the desktop.
At first I loaded up both characters into a game, ran process explorer to close handle for the second instance so I can run the third.
I run the third .exe and it tells me 'This folder doesn't contain the correct version of this game. Please check the installation path and try again.'
I've uninstalled and reinstalled and recreated all folders. I've double checked all paths and they are linked to the correct folders. Can't seem to find any help on google when trying to find info about running a third D2R.
Hopefully someone has an easy fix. Thanks.

Edit: It also gives me the same error when I just try to run 1 D2R from the third folder.
